9 in Stock
9 in Stock
available to order
available to order
106 in Stock
only 1 left
106 in Stock
only 1 left
9 in Stock
9 in Stock
available to order
available to order
106 in Stock
only 1 left
106 in Stock
only 1 left
106 in Stock
only 1 left
only 1 left
only 1 left
106 in Stock
only 1 left
122 in Stock
58 in Stock
60 in Stock
58 in Stock
122 in Stock
58 in Stock
only 2 left
198 in Stock
559 in Stock
51 in Stock
79 in Stock
72 in Stock
25 in Stock
152 in Stock
51 in Stock
60 in Stock
only 1 left
36 in Stock
38 in Stock
88 in Stock
92 in Stock
37 in Stock
29 in Stock
28 in Stock
available to order
9 in Stock
9 in Stock
20 in Stock